- ACG Clinical Guideline: Management of Irritable Bowel Syndrome
We recommend the use of chloride channel activators and guanylate cyclase activators to treat global IBS with constipation symptoms We recommend the use of rifaximin to treat global IBS with diarrhea symptoms We suggest that gut-directed psychotherapy be used to treat global IBS symptoms
